返回

移动端布局自适应黑科技,解锁端共用代码新姿势

前端

移动端布局自适应设计指南

响应式设计的重要性

随着移动互联网的飞速发展,越来越多的用户开始使用移动设备上网。为了给用户提供更好的体验,网站都开始采用移动端布局。与PC端布局相比,移动端布局需要适应不同大小手机和平板电脑屏幕,因此在设计时需要考虑一些特殊的问题。

首先,移动端布局需要做到响应式。 这意味着网站的布局能够根据屏幕大小自动调整,以确保在任何设备上都能正常显示。

@media (max-width: 768px) {
  body {
    font-size: 14px;
  }
}

其次,移动端布局需要注重内容的简洁性。 由于移动设备的屏幕尺寸有限,因此在设计时应尽量避免使用过多的文本和图片,以确保用户能够快速找到所需信息。

<div class="row">
  <div class="col-sm-6">
    <h1>标题</h1>
    <p>正文</p>
  </div>
  <div class="col-sm-6">
    <img src="image.jpg" alt="图片">
  </div>
</div>

第三,移动端布局需要易于操作。 由于移动设备的操作方式与PC端不同,因此在设计时应尽量避免使用复杂的操作手势,以确保用户能够轻松操作网站。

<button type="button" class="btn btn-primary">按钮</button>

移动端布局设计原则

除了上述几点之外,在设计移动端布局时还需要注意以下几点:

  • 使用合适的字体和字号。 由于移动设备的屏幕尺寸有限,因此在选择字体时应尽量选择清晰易读的字体,并且字号应适当放大。
  • 使用高清图片。 由于移动设备的屏幕分辨率较高,因此在选择图片时应尽量使用高清图片,以确保图片能够在移动设备上清晰显示。
  • 避免使用Flash和Java等插件。 由于移动设备通常不支持Flash和Java等插件,因此在设计移动端布局时应尽量避免使用这些插件。
  • 注意网站的加载速度。 由于移动设备的网络速度通常较慢,因此在设计移动端布局时应尽量减少页面元素的数量,以确保网站能够快速加载。

移动端与PC端共用一套代码

在以往,移动端和PC端通常使用不同的代码库,这使得网站的维护变得非常困难。随着技术的发展,如今已经可以使用一套代码同时开发移动端和PC端网站。这种技术被称为响应式设计。

响应式设计是一种非常灵活的设计方法,它允许网站的布局根据屏幕大小自动调整。这样一来,您就可以使用一套代码同时开发出适应各种设备的网站。

使用响应式设计的注意事项

在使用响应式设计时,您需要注意以下几点:

  • 使用合适的框架。 目前,市面上有许多响应式设计框架可供选择,例如Bootstrap、Foundation和Material Design Lite。这些框架可以帮助您快速构建出响应式的网站。
  • 使用媒体查询。 媒体查询是一种CSS技术,它允许您根据屏幕大小来定义不同的样式规则。这样一来,您就可以针对不同的设备定义不同的样式,以确保网站能够在所有设备上正常显示。
  • 注意网站的性能。 由于响应式设计会使用更多的CSS和JavaScript代码,因此您需要特别注意网站的性能。您需要对网站进行优化,以确保它能够快速加载。

结论

移动端布局自适应设计和移动端与PC端共用一套代码是当今Web设计中的两大趋势。掌握这些技术,您将能够设计出更美观、更实用、更易用的网站。

常见问题解答

  • 响应式设计与自适应设计的区别是什么?

响应式设计和自适应设计都是网页设计技术,但它们的工作方式不同。响应式设计使用一套代码来适应不同设备的屏幕大小,而自适应设计使用不同的代码库来创建针对特定设备的布局。

  • 使用响应式设计有哪些好处?

使用响应式设计的主要好处包括:

* 减少维护成本
* 改善用户体验
* 提高网站排名
  • 使用响应式设计的最佳实践是什么?

使用响应式设计的最佳实践包括:

* 使用合适的框架
* 使用媒体查询
* 注意网站的性能
  • 如何测试响应式网站?

测试响应式网站的最佳方法是使用不同的设备和屏幕尺寸进行测试。您还可以使用在线工具来测试网站的响应能力。

  • 响应式设计有哪些局限性?

响应式设计的局限性包括:

* 可能会导致页面加载时间较长
* 可能会导致网站功能受限
* 可能会导致网站设计不一致